Simplifying 78 = -9x + -3[-56 + 12x] 78 = -9x + [-56 * -3 + 12x * -3] 78 = -9x + [168 + -36x] Reorder the terms: 78 = 168 + -9x + -36x Combine like terms: -9x + -36x = -45x 78 = 168 + -45x Solving 78 = 168 + -45x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'45x' to each side of the equation. 78 + 45x = 168 + -45x + 45x Combine like terms: -45x + 45x = 0 78 + 45x = 168 + 0 78 + 45x = 168 Add '-78' to each side of the equation. 78 + -78 + 45x = 168 + -78 Combine like terms: 78 + -78 = 0 0 + 45x = 168 + -78 45x = 168 + -78 Combine like terms: 168 + -78 = 90 45x = 90 Divide each side by '45'. x = 2 Simplifying x = 2
